1. Succulents: The Perfect Petite Plants

Succulents have gained immense popularity in recent years, and for good reason. These small, fleshy plants come in a variety of shapes, colors, and textures, making them a versatile choice for any interior. With their ability to store water in their leaves, succulents are incredibly low-maintenance, making them ideal for busy individuals or those with limited gardening experience.

Some popular succulent varieties for small interiors include:

  • Aloe Vera: Known for its medicinal properties, Aloe Vera is not only a beautiful addition to any space, but it also purifies the air.
  • Jade Plant: With its thick, glossy leaves, the Jade Plant adds a touch of elegance to small interiors. It is also believed to bring good luck and prosperity.
  • Echeveria: These rosette-shaped succulents come in various colors, from pale green to deep purple, and thrive in bright, indirect light.

2. Air Plants: Space-Saving Beauties

If you're short on space, air plants are the perfect solution. These unique plants do not require soil to grow and can be displayed in creative ways, such as hanging from the ceiling or mounted on walls. Air plants absorb moisture and nutrients through their leaves, making them extremely adaptable to various environments.

When it comes to air plants, Tillandsia is the most popular genus. These plants come in a wide range of shapes and sizes, allowing you to choose the perfect one for your petite interior. Some popular Tillandsia varieties include:

  • Tillandsia Ionantha: With its vibrant, red color and compact size, Tillandsia Ionantha is a favorite among air plant enthusiasts. It is also one of the easiest to care for.
  • Tillandsia Bulbosa: This unique air plant features long, curly leaves that give it an exotic appearance. It thrives in bright, indirect light.
  • Tillandsia Xerographica: Known for its stunning rosette shape and silver-gray foliage, Tillandsia Xerographica can be a statement piece in any small interior.

3. Hanging Plants: Utilizing Vertical Space

When floor space is limited, it's time to think vertically. Hanging plants are a fantastic way to add greenery to small interiors without sacrificing valuable surface area. These plants can be suspended from the ceiling or mounted on the wall, creating a stunning visual display while saving space.

Some popular hanging plant options include:

  • Spider Plant: With its arching leaves and small white flowers, the Spider Plant is a classic choice for any hanging display. It is also known for its air purifying abilities.
  • String of Pearls: This trailing succulent features spherical leaves that resemble a string of pearls, hence its name. It adds a unique touch to any interior and thrives in bright, indirect light.
  • English Ivy: Known for its ability to purify the air, English Ivy is a popular choice for hanging baskets. Its cascading foliage adds a touch of elegance to any space.

4. Herb Gardens: Combining Beauty and Functionality

Why settle for just decorative plants when you can have ones that also serve a practical purpose? Herb gardens are a fantastic option for small interiors, as they provide fresh ingredients for cooking while adding a delightful aroma to your space. Additionally, herbs are generally compact and easy to maintain, making them ideal for petite places.

Some popular herbs for small interiors include:

  • Basil: This aromatic herb is a staple in many cuisines and thrives in a sunny spot. Its vibrant green leaves add a pop of color to any interior.
  • Mint: Known for its refreshing flavor, mint is a perfect choice for small interiors. However, it is important to keep it in a separate container, as it can quickly invade other plants' space.
  • Parsley: With its curly or flat leaves, parsley is not only a versatile herb for cooking but also a visually appealing addition to any petite interior.

5. Bonsai Trees: Tiny Trees with Big Impact

If you're looking to add a touch of elegance and tranquility to your small interior, bonsai trees are an excellent choice. These miniature trees are meticulously pruned and shaped to create stunning works of living art. While bonsai trees require more care and attention than other plants on this list, they are well worth the effort.

Some popular bonsai tree varieties for small interiors include:

  • Juniper Bonsai: Known for its unique, twisted trunk and lush foliage, the Juniper Bonsai is a classic choice for bonsai enthusiasts. It requires bright, indirect light and regular pruning.
  • Ficus Bonsai: With its glossy leaves and aerial roots, the Ficus Bonsai adds a tropical touch to any small interior. It thrives in bright, indirect light and requires regular watering.
  • Japanese Maple Bonsai: This stunning bonsai tree features delicate, palmate leaves that change color with the seasons. It requires a cool and humid environment, making it ideal for small interiors with controlled temperature and humidity.
